[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

SF.net SVN: ledger-smb:[2475] trunk/scripts/payment.pl



Revision: 2475
          http://ledger-smb.svn.sourceforge.net/ledger-smb/?rev=2475&view=rev
Author:   einhverfr
Date:     2009-03-04 22:02:17 +0000 (Wed, 04 Mar 2009)

Log Message:
-----------
Fixing one more format safety issue on payments

Modified Paths:
--------------
    trunk/scripts/payment.pl

Modified: trunk/scripts/payment.pl
===================================================================
--- trunk/scripts/payment.pl	2009-03-04 21:27:01 UTC (rev 2474)
+++ trunk/scripts/payment.pl	2009-03-04 22:02:17 UTC (rev 2475)
@@ -379,8 +379,10 @@
                   or (defined $payment->{"id_$_->{contact_id}"})){
                    if ($payment->{"paid_$_->{contact_id}"} eq 'some'){
                       my $i_id = $invoice->[0];
+                      my $payment_amt = $payment->parse_amount(
+				amount => $payment->{"payment_$i_id"});
                       $contact_total 
-                              += $payment->{"payment_$i_id"};
+                              += $payment_amt;
                    } 
             }
             $invoice->[3] = $payment->format_amount(amount => $invoice->[3], 


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.